Ascension Materials Breakdown

Preparing Chasca for her full potential involves gathering resources across multiple regions with special focus on Natlan's newest additions. The excitement of finally accessing previously unavailable materials like the Ensnaring Gaze creates a tangible sense of progression since Version 5.2's launch. Here's the essential checklist every adventurer needs:

  • Vayuda Turquoise Stones: Farmed primarily from Anemo-aligned bosses with the Tenebrous Papilla: Type I being the most efficient source since its introduction. The satisfaction of seeing those teal gemstones drop never fades, especially knowing they're transforming Chasca into an aerial powerhouse.

Recommended Boss Route:

  • Tenebrous Papilla: Type I (Natlan)

  • Anemo Hypostasis (Mondstadt)

  • Setekh Wenut (Sumeru Desert)

  • Ensnaring Gaze: Exclusively obtained from defeating the Tenebrous Papilla boss added in Version 5.2. The adrenaline rush of learning this boss's patterns while anticipating the material drop creates memorable combat moments. Players need approximately 46 pieces for full ascension - a journey best undertaken with co-op companions.

  • Withering Purpurbloom: Natlan's vibrant purple specialty found exclusively in Ochkanatlan. 🌺 There's something meditative about tracing the mountain paths every 48 hours during respawn cycles, watching the sunrise while gathering these glowing blossoms. Pro tip: equip character passive talents that highlight local specialties to streamline collection.

  • Fang Series Materials: Juvenile, Seasoned, and Tyrant's Fangs drop abundantly from Saurian enemies throughout Natlan. The rhythmic combat against these reptilian foes becomes surprisingly enjoyable when imagining each victory strengthening Chasca's capabilities.

Total Mora Requirements

Purpose Amount
Ascension Process 420,000
Level 90 Upgrade 1,637,400
Combined Total 2,057,400

Talent Materials Strategy

Maximizing Chasca's combat effectiveness requires even greater dedication to talent development, where material quantities increase dramatically. The grind intensifies but so does the satisfaction when seeing those golden talent crowns finally slot into place.

  • Fang Materials Revisited: Significantly larger quantities needed compared to ascension. Fighting Saurians evolves from routine to ritual - the satisfying crunch of landing critical hits while knowing each fang collected translates directly to deadlier aerial assaults.

  • Conflict Talent Books: Farmed exclusively at the Blazing Ruins Domain during specific days. 🔥 The cyclical nature of Wednesday/Saturday/Sunday farming creates a comforting weekly rhythm:

  • Teachings of Conflict (Blue)

  • Guide to Conflict (Purple)

  • Philosophies of Conflict (Gold)

Pro Tip: Use condensed resin on Sundays when all tiers become available

  • Silken Feather: Weekly boss material obtained from confronting The Knave. The thrill of challenge escalates with each unsuccessful drop, mitigated only by the knowledge that Dream Solvents can convert unwanted materials. Having spare solvents feels like holding insurance against RNG frustration.

  • Crowns of Insight: These precious golden artifacts remain the ultimate talent upgrade currency. The pride in slotting one into Chasca's talents reflects months of event participation and reputation building - true badges of dedication.

Mora Investment for Talents

Upgrading all three talents to maximum consumes nearly 5 million Mora - a staggering amount that makes Blossoms of Wealth in Natlan feel like second homes. Farming these alongside Saurians creates wonderfully efficient resource loops.
